What does code 10-11 indicate in police dispatch terms?

Explanation:
In police radio communications, 10-codes are shorthand used to convey common events quickly. The meaning of 10-11 is “Dispatched Too Rapidly,” indicating that a unit was sent out before proper coordination or readiness was established. This timing cue helps supervisors manage resources and prevent confusion or unsafe responses by pausing or rechecking dispatches as needed.
